INTEGRATED LIQUID DISPENSING SYSTEM AND METHOD OF MANUFACTURE AND USE
20260048975 · 2026-02-19 · ·

An integrated liquid dispensing system and method of its manufacture and use includes a mounting portion, a collar attached to its top face, a plurality of actuators, wherein at least an actuator of the plurality of actuators is configured to move along an axis between a first position and a second position, to include a proximal end and a distal end, to engage its distal end with at least a switch to start a liquid flow when in the first position, and to disengage its distal end from the at least a switch to stop the liquid flow when in the second position, and a control unit communicatively connected to the plurality of actuators, wherein the control unit is configured to receive a user input, determine an amount of liquid to dispense as a function of the user input, and dispense the amount of liquid.

Methods and systems for secure, metered beverage dispensing

Methods and systems for accurately and securely dispensing high value beverages are presented herein. A beverage distribution system includes one or more replaceable beverage cartridges mounted to a beverage dispensing device. Each of the beverage cartridges includes a fluid reservoir with an output port, an output control valve, a flowmeter, and a local controller. The local controller receives signals from the flow meter and determines a cumulative amount of beverage fluid dispensed from the beverage cartridge based on the received signals. In one embodiment, the beverage dispensing device includes a fluid pump and a master controller. The master controller also estimates the cumulative amount of beverage fluid dispensed from each beverage cartridge based on control commands communicated to each beverage cartridge. If a difference between the estimated cumulative amounts of fluid dispensed from a beverage cartridge exceeds a predetermined threshold value, an alert is generated.
